Through the first two games of the season, the Vikings have found ways to put their fans through a variety of different emotions.

In Week 2, Minnesota took the early lead against Arizona when quarterback Kirk Cousins threw a touchdown pass to wide receiver K.J. Osborn.

The Vikings almost forced a turnover when cornerback Bashaud Breeland knocked the ball out of wide receiver Rondale Moore’s hands before he could reach the end zone, but the ball technically went out of bounds. Then, the Cardinals made it a one-possession game when Kyler Murray ran in for the score.

Murray used his arm on Arizona’s next touchdown, finding Moore on a 77-yard touchdown pass that helped the Cardinals take the lead with the extra point.

The Vikings got one more drive on offense in the first half, and put kicker Greg Joseph in range to hit a 52-yard field goal. Cardinals kicker Matt Prater helped Arizona retake the lead when he hit a 62-yarder as time expired in the half. At the time this article was published, the Cardinals led the Vikings 24-23.
